Einzelnen Beitrag anzeigen

Benutzerbild von MacGuyver
MacGuyver

Registriert seit: 9. Sep 2003
Ort: Wildeshausen
295 Beiträge
 
Turbo Delphi für Win32
 
#5

Re: Wert TDateTime im Debugger anzeigen

  Alt 12. Sep 2007, 13:21
Ich will das an der Stelle doch nicht haben.


Ich habe aber die Lösung gefunden:

FormatDateTime('dd.mm.YYYY" um "hh:mm:ss',aDate)

Das Teil in die überwachten Ausdrücke eintragen und die Checkbox "Funktionsaufrufe gestattet" anhaken. Schwupp! Da ist auch schon das Datum mit Uhrzeit in gewünschter Form. Noch geiler wird es, wenn man eingene Funktionen einbindet:

Delphi-Quellcode:
funtion DateToStr( aDate : TDateTime):String;

begin
  Result:='Aber Hallo!';
end;
Dann mal eben in die überwachten Ausdrücke "DateToStr(aDate)" eintragen und die Checkbox setzten. Siehe da, da steht dann sogar "Aber Hallo!" in der Liste. Geil. Ach so, die Funktion muss auch im Programm verwendet werden, sonst nimmt der Compiler das raus. Am einfachsten im Init

Delphi-Quellcode:
begin
  if DateToStr(0) = 'then ;
end.
eine leere Abfrage einbauen.


Stefan
Englisch eine Weltsprache? Zu kompliziert und der nahe Osten würde Englisch als Pflichtweltsprache nicht akzeptieren.
IDO wäre genau das Richtige: http://forum.idolinguo.de/index.php oder www.idolinguo.de
  Mit Zitat antworten Zitat